I request that the relevant authors and IETF working group
rename what it currently calls "LISP" to something else.  To
put it politely, the IETF should be standing on the shoulders
of the giants who have laid the groundwork of the Internet,
not stepping on their toes.
I strongly support this.

More generally, I wish we would just stop using names for WGs
that are widely understood to mean something else in computer
science, software engineering, or networking.  Despite good
intentions, it cannot be a mark of respect or homage when the WG
name overlays a term the refers to a particular invention or
development.  At least IMO, the cuteness wears off very quickly
and only confusion or disrespect are left.
